Gasoline Credit Cards in 2010
If you're looking to save money this upcoming Summer because of the outrageous gas prices, I wanted to give you some tips on how you can save with a gasoline credit card.
First of all, you're probably wondering how the heck you can get one? For starters, you're going to need a good credit score.
Without a good credit score, you're more than likely going to get denied for the card.
it doesn't hurt to try to apply for one though.
What you're going to find out is that there is a big selection of cards out there and all gasoline companies vary.
Next, you're going to ask yourself if you're loyal? Do you fill up at the same gas station all the time? If you're shaking your head yes, you're going to want to get a card that's associated with that station.
The only downfall to this is that you're going to find out that they are limited across the globe.
If you're not loyal to a particular gas station, you can get a card that's going to work everywhere.
This is the type of card that I usually like to carry around.

Listed below are a few things that you're going to have to look out for when you're looking to apply for a card.
- The fees - Make sure that the card isn't jammed packed with fees.
- Rewards - Make sure that you're getting the most out of your rewards.
Make sure that you're getting the best percentage rate. - Read the fine print - That percentage may be for the first few months.
Make sure that it's not an intro rate.
You want to make sure it lasts a long time.
